Discover More/Darganfod Mwy:Sibelius
Sibelius’ music immediately connects us to Finnish forests, lakes and mountains. It is the Sound of the North, distilled into poem and symphony. But what specifically in the score helps us make that connection? What devices and tricks does he use? And how did Nielsen, a proud Dane, emerge from the Finn’s shadow? / Mae cerddoriaeth Sibelius yn mynd â ni’n syth i goedwigoedd, llynnoedd a mynyddoedd y Ffindir.
